Traffic Diversions on Ring Road Flyover for 2 Months Due to Surat Metro Work
June 16, 2026
Surat: Amid the ongoing work on the Surat Metro Rail project, the Gujarat Metro Rail Corporation (GMRC) is set to carry out pier cap work on metro pillars near Ring Road on the Bhestan-Saroli route. As a result, traffic diversions will remain in effect on the Ring Road flyover for the next 62 days.
According to the traffic diversion plan announced by the authorities, all heavy vehicles travelling from the Mandarwaja Ring Road overbridge towards Sahara Darwaja and the railway station will not be allowed to use the flyover. An alternative route has been provided, directing heavy vehicles to pass beneath the bridge.
Similarly, the entry of heavy vehicles from Sahara Darwaja towards the Mandarwaja Ring Road overbridge has also been prohibited. Drivers have been advised to use the route beneath the bridge.
As the Mandarwaja Ring Road bridge approach from Bombay Market has also been closed to heavy vehicles, alternate routes have been designated for those heading towards Udhna Darwaja. Heavy vehicles can travel via the road beneath the Parvat Patiya bridge and proceed through Kabutar Circle, Anjana Farm and Kinnari Cinema to reach Udhna Darwaja.
Alternatively, drivers can take the route from Anjana Bridge via the Bhathena overbridge and Rokadiya Hanuman Mandir Road to reach Udhna Darwaja.
Heavy vehicles travelling from Falsawadi towards Mandarwaja have also been directed to pass beneath the overbridge. In addition, the flyover will remain closed to light vehicles between 11 pm and 6 am during the construction period. DeshGujarat
